Output 3704efd2422017706ad193d8d628ab99eaff293572c710822db01c3ea01ef9ab:0

value
23997760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 790b8ec76a43cbde4fd0f8d06ef6d4c48f655f50 OP_EQUALVERIFY OP_CHECKSIG
address
1C32cFtQxffKAk6UsNYsb585NJhZDnJekH
transaction
3704efd2422017706ad193d8d628ab99eaff293572c710822db01c3ea01ef9ab
spent
true